Transaction f127e589ce625217d608cd51260379b9b9895d9f2b6938ba592dd2f300ec638e

block
c16ac6b70e7e4a0840bde6239f742f3cb02d0462a1886950ddb2d1a995b0c198

1 Input

23 Outputs